Trainee Patent Attorney - Chemistry

The Position

We are looking for an enthusiastic Chemistry graduate to join our team in Leeds. 

 

This is an intellectually demanding, rigorous profession where the work is fascinating, and the profession is highly respected.  The Patent Attorney role requires a unique combination of science, law and business to assist a diverse range of clients in protecting their innovations. On the job support will be provided to you each step of the way to help you learn all the necessary law and skills to become a first-class patent attorney.

 

Our Leeds chemistry team work for a mix of UK and overseas clients, including SMEs, multinationals and universities.  While the team has a particular emphasis on pharmaceuticals, they also handle a stimulating range of other chemistry related technologies, including carbon capture, agrochemicals, research tools, dye technology, and advanced materials.

 

The training process is a challenging one and we offer exceptional support in helping you get through it. This includes access to your own training budget, an internal tutorial program, access to our in house L&D platform and working with qualified attorneys who have a deep understanding of what it is like to be a trainee, having been there and done it in the not so long and distant past. There is so much knowledge you can tap into, including supervision from experienced partners and senior attorneys, supporting you on your journey to full Chartered UK and European qualification.

 

A typical working week could include

  • Drafting of patent documents for review by manager
  • Supporting a diverse range of clients to achieve their commercial objectives.
  • Construct technical arguments with a view to prosecuting or opposing patents
  • Working with Attorneys in ensuring that legal deadlines are met
  • Liaising with clients and answering queries
  • Progressing through UK and European Patent Attorney Qualification exams alongside work
